| powered by ati vs made by ati drivers? Does anyone know if there is a significant difference between the two drivers. I recenty tried both versions for cats 3.2. For some reason the made by ati graphics look better (could be my imagination) then the powered by ati which seems a little better performance wise. Can anyone confirm this? I did these tests using a moded saphhire radeon 9500/9700 (its the red card version). |

| I cannot answer your question, although I use the drivers for "made by ATI" cards with my "powered by ATI" Sapphire card. I also had poorer results with the drivers for "powered by ATI" cards, although it has been a while and I do not recall what the difference was. Incidentally, the Catalyst 3.1 drivers cleared up the last problem I had, so I am not planning on updating anything unless some future problem comes along. |
